Thai marines rescue starving lions, bears from Cambodian border casino
Officials say the two lions, two Asiatic black bears and one sun bear suffered from underfeeding and prolonged neglect at Thmor Dar Casino

DNP chief Atthapol Charoenchansa said the animals’ ribs were visible and tranquillising them posed a high risk of heart failure.
Atthapol said veterinarians administered vitamins to the animals as soldiers and park officials raced against time to move the cages out of the conflict-torn area.
The bears were eventually transported to the Bang Lamung Wildlife Breeding Station in Chon Buri where they are recovering, while the lions found a new home at the Khao Son Wildlife Breeding Station in Ratchaburi.
Officials said they were collecting evidence and verifying the animals’ origins to take legal action under Thai wildlife conservation laws, The Nation Thailand reported.
